From: Roger Quadros <rogerq@ti.com>
Updates OCP master port configuration to enable memory access outside
of the PRU-ICSS subsystem.
This set of changes configures PRUSS_SYSCFG.STANDBY_INIT bit either
to enable or disable the OCP master ports (applicable only on SoCs
using OCP interconnect like the OMAP family).

+/**
+ * pruss_cfg_ocp_master_ports() - configure PRUSS OCP master ports
+ * @pruss: the pruss instance handle
+ * @enable: set to true for enabling or false for disabling the OCP master ports
+ *
+ * This function programs the PRUSS_SYSCFG.STANDBY_INIT bit either to enable or
+ * disable the OCP master ports (applicable only on SoCs using OCP interconnect
+ * like the OMAP family). Clearing the bit achieves dual functionalities - one
+ * is to deassert the MStandby signal to the device PRCM, and the other is to
+ * enable OCP master ports to allow accesses outside of the PRU-ICSS. The
+ * function has to wait for the PRCM to acknowledge through the monitoring of
+ * the PRUSS_SYSCFG.SUB_MWAIT bit when enabling master ports. Setting the bit
+ * disables the master access, and also signals the PRCM that the PRUSS is ready
+ * for Standby.
+ *
+ * Return: 0 on success, or an error code otherwise. ETIMEDOUT is returned
+ * when the ready-state fails.
+ */
+int pruss_cfg_ocp_master_ports(struct pruss *pruss, bool enable)
+{
+ const struct pruss_private_data *data;
+ u32 syscfg_val, i;
+ int ret;
+
+ if (IS_ERR_OR_NULL(pruss))
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 data = of_device_get_match_data(pruss->dev);
+
+ /* nothing to do on non OMAP-SoCs */
+ if (!data || !data->has_ocp_syscfg)
+ return 0;
+
+ /* assert the MStandby signal during disable path */
+ if (!enable)
+ return pruss_cfg_update(pruss, PRUSS_CFG_SYSCFG,
+ SYSCFG_STANDBY_INIT,
+ SYSCFG_STANDBY_INIT);
+
+ /* enable the OCP master ports and disable MStandby */
+ ret = pruss_cfg_update(pruss, PRUSS_CFG_SYSCFG, SYSCFG_STANDBY_INIT, 0);
+ if (ret)
+ return ret;
+
+ /* wait till we are ready for transactions - delay is arbitrary */
+ for (i = 0; i < 10; i++) {
+ ret = pruss_cfg_read(pruss, PRUSS_CFG_SYSCFG, &syscfg_val);
+ if (ret)
+ goto disable;
+
+ if (!(syscfg_val & SYSCFG_SUB_MWAIT_READY))
+ return 0;
+
+ udelay(5);
+ }
+
+ dev_err(pruss->dev, "timeout waiting for SUB_MWAIT_READY\n");
+ ret = -ETIMEDOUT;
+
+disable:
+ pruss_cfg_update(pruss, PRUSS_CFG_SYSCFG, SYSCFG_STANDBY_INIT,
+ SYSCFG_STANDBY_INIT);
+ return ret;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(pruss_cfg_ocp_master_ports);

On the verge of applying this patch, looking deeper, I noticed
drivers/bus/ti-sysc.c managing the sysc controls. infact, I wonder if
b2745d92bb015cc4454d4195c4ce6e2852db397e ("bus: ti-sysc: Add support
for PRUSS SYSC type") could be merged with this?
Could you say why drivers/bus/ti-sysc.c would'nt be the right solution?
Ccying Kevin if he has any ideas about this.

We've reviewed the code and decided to bypass the SOC patch posted here.
Instead, we have implemented the required changes in the "drivers/bus/ti-sysc.c"
file to enable OCMC access to the PRU-ICSS and verified the Ethernet
functionality over PRUETH on AM335x, AM437x and AM57x platforms.
This patch will be abandoned and a new patch will be posted with
"drivers/bus/ti-sysc.c" changes shortly.
